iOS 27 Public Beta is earning unusually positive early reactions for performance, particularly from people who felt their iPhones had become slower, warmer or less responsive under iOS 26.
The most enthusiastic responses are not necessarily coming from owners of the newest hardware. iPhone 13 users are reporting some of the most noticeable changes in animation smoothness, keyboard responsiveness and app opening times. Owners of iPhone 11 models are also seeing visible gains, although aging batteries can limit how much improvement reaches the screen.
Newer devices such as iPhone 16 Pro, iPhone 17 and iPhone Air appear to provide the most stable experience, but the performance difference is less dramatic because those models were already fast under iOS 26.
The early favorite therefore depends on the measurement. The iPhone 13 family currently stands out for the largest perceived improvement, while iPhone 16 and iPhone 17 models receive stronger reviews for overall stability. The iPhone 15 Pro family sits between those groups, with impressive speed reports complicated by inconsistent heat and battery behavior.
iOS 27 Public Beta Has Official Speed Targets
The faster behavior is not limited to subjective impressions.
Apple says app launches can be up to 30% faster in iOS 27. Its testing used an iPhone 11 Pro Max running iOS 26.4.2 and prerelease iOS 27 after repeated cycles of device use.
That choice is significant. Apple did not demonstrate the app-launch claim only on its newest processor. It used a model introduced in 2019, suggesting that the operating-system work was intended to improve aging devices rather than simply take advantage of newer chips.
Apple also claims new photographs can appear in the Photos library up to 70% faster, based on testing with an iPhone 15 and a library containing 50,000 items. AirDrop transfers can be up to 80% faster under specific conditions tested with an iPhone 16 Plus.
The company attributes part of the change to improvements at the core of the system, including an optimized CPU scheduler. The scheduler determines how tasks are distributed across processor cores, when background activity receives resources and how quickly the system responds to foreground actions.
That work can improve responsiveness without increasing the maximum benchmark score of the processor. An app may feel faster because iOS recognizes the request sooner, assigns the correct cores more efficiently and reduces unnecessary work competing in the background.
Independent launch testing on iPhone 17 models has also found measurable improvements in Safari, Photos, Camera and third-party apps. The gains vary considerably by application, showing that the “up to” figures should not be expected during every routine.
iPhone 13 Receives the Strongest Speed Reactions
The iPhone 13 family is producing some of the most consistently enthusiastic public feedback.
Users describe faster keyboard response, fewer dropped frames, quicker app switching and smoother scrolling than they experienced under later versions of iOS 26. Some reactions compare the change with installing a fresh operating system on a newer phone.
The A15 Bionic processor remains powerful enough for ordinary iPhone work, but the iPhone 13 is old enough for software inefficiencies to become visible. That combination makes scheduling and animation improvements easier to notice.
The iPhone 13 Pro and iPhone 13 Pro Max may benefit even more perceptually because their ProMotion displays can refresh at up to 120Hz. When the interface maintains its intended frame rate, scrolling and transitions appear substantially smoother than they do when inconsistent performance introduces brief stutters.
Standard iPhone 13 and iPhone 13 mini models retain 60Hz displays, but owners still report improvements in typing, opening applications and moving between Home Screen pages.
Battery condition remains a major variable. An iPhone 13 with a heavily degraded battery may reduce peak performance or deliver poor endurance regardless of operating-system efficiency.
To check battery health before judging the beta:
Settings > Battery > Battery Health & Charging
A low maximum-capacity percentage does not mean iOS 27 provides no performance improvement. It means the battery may be unable to support the same sustained power delivery and daily runtime as it did when new.
iPhone 15 Pro Shows Major Gains and Mixed Heat Reports
The iPhone 15 Pro and iPhone 15 Pro Max are receiving some of the strongest comments about reduced stuttering and faster app launches.
Several users who experienced frequent heat under iOS 26 describe their devices as cooler and more responsive after installing iOS 27. Others continue to report warming, particularly after moving between beta builds or while the phone performs background work.
The divided feedback makes the iPhone 15 Pro difficult to rank as the definitive winner. Its best reports are among the most positive, but its experience appears less consistent than the feedback surrounding the iPhone 13 or newer iPhone 16 models.
The titanium iPhone 15 Pro generation has attracted heat complaints since its introduction, and temperature depends on more than the processor. Cellular signal strength, battery condition, charging, screen brightness, camera use and background indexing can all warm the enclosure.
A phone may also become temporarily hot after installing the public beta while Photos analyzes images, Spotlight rebuilds its index and applications update internal data.
Users should allow at least 24 to 48 hours before deciding whether the new system permanently improved or worsened thermal behavior.
The iPhone 14 Pro and iPhone 14 Pro Max are receiving generally favorable reviews for interface smoothness and keyboard behavior. Reports are not universal, with some owners continuing to experience heat or lag. The largest improvements appear on devices that previously struggled with animation consistency under iOS 26.
Newer iPhones Deliver the Safest Beta Experience
The iPhone 16 family, iPhone 17 lineup and iPhone Air appear to offer the most dependable performance in the first public beta.
Their newer processors, additional memory and stronger support for Apple Intelligence give iOS more room to operate without placing the hardware under continuous pressure. Owners frequently describe the beta as unexpectedly stable for a July release.
The perceived speed increase is usually smaller. A fast iPhone 17 Pro cannot create the same before-and-after impression as an iPhone 13 that previously stuttered while typing or switching apps.
The newer models also receive more of the headline iOS 27 features. Apple Intelligence is supported on every iPhone 16 and later, along with iPhone 15 Pro and iPhone 15 Pro Max. Older compatible devices receive the core performance, design and application improvements but not the complete AI package.
The iPhone 11 and iPhone 12 families provide the opposite experience. They may show a surprisingly visible improvement in app responsiveness, but their age increases the chance of battery degradation, limited free storage and heat caused by inefficient charging or weak cellular reception.
How to Test the Speed Improvement Fairly
Performance should not be judged immediately after the installation finishes.
Leave the iPhone connected to power and Wi-Fi for several hours so indexing, photo analysis and application updates can progress. Restart the phone once after that initial period and use it normally for at least one full day.
Before installing, record how long frequently used apps take to open and note whether the keyboard, Camera, Photos library or App Switcher regularly stutters. Repeat the same routines after the beta settles.
Free storage also affects behavior.
To check the available capacity:
Settings > General > iPhone Storage
Keeping several gigabytes free gives iOS room for temporary files, updates, caches and background processing. A nearly full iPhone can remain slow even when the operating system itself is more efficient.
How to Install or Disable the Public Beta
Apple recommends using beta software on a secondary device rather than a business-critical or primary iPhone. A backup should be created before installation.
To enable the iOS 27 Public Beta:
Settings > General > Software Update > Beta Updates > iOS 27 Public Beta
Return to Software Update and install the available build. The Apple Account used on the iPhone must be enrolled in the Apple Beta Software Program.
To stop receiving future beta releases:
Settings > General > Software Update > Beta Updates > Off
Turning beta updates off does not immediately return the iPhone to iOS 26. It keeps the installed system and waits until a compatible public release becomes available.
